Motors, Motor and more Motors!
Ages 8-13           Mondays          January 11, 25   February 1, 8                 12:30pm - 2:00pm              

Students will learn how motors work, take apart and assemble various motorized objects, create circuits and finally build their own motor. These hands on lessons will have students learning how motors use magnets to create motion through research, observation, inquiry and creation!

Erosion
Ages 7-13           Mondays             April 4, 11, 18, 25                                  12:30pm - 2:00pm                   

Students will use an erosion table and create 3D building that will be used to simulate various water conditions that result in flooding and erosion. They will become civil engineers, solving problems associated with water flow, building design and structure placement to create solutions to common issues created by laminar and turbulent water flow over the soil.
